Title: Brigade # 1 Remastered Publisher: Image Comics Story/Writer: Rob Liefeld Artists: Viktor Bogdanovic, Dietrich Smith, Ryan Kincaid, Raymond Leonard/Paul Scott, Ron Williams, Paul Scott, Clay Mann, Dan Fraga, Marat Mychaels/Norm Rapmund, Cory Hamscher, Ed Piskor, Philip Tan, Karl Alstaetter, Jim Rugg, V Ken Marian, Tom Scioli, Norm Rapmund, Thomas Hedglen/Matthew Seaborne, Mike Choi, Rob Liefeld/Matthew Seaborne Colors: Juan Rodriguez Letters: Rus Wootan Brigade Created by: Rob Liefeld Price: $ 3.99 US Rating: 2 out of 5 stars Website: www.imagecomics.comComments: Battlestone, Coldsnap, Seahawk, Atlas, Thermal, Status and Kayo make up Brigade. This team does work great as a team. Well except for Seahawk being a bit to bloodthirsty. The story flows by way to fast. The introduction to the team is well enough done. You meet each of the characters except Status who shows up later. The two brothers fight as brothers tend to only here they have powers. Battlestone makes for a stern leader. The art varies with so many artists working on this book. Some styles are gorgeous and others more ameteurish. The use of Atlas in the fighting did not work. Having him just stand outside while the other members fight just seems wrong. Having the team fight other people with powers using them for evil would have been better. Battlestone is the best character in this issue. He is the team leader and he is shown knowing what to do to lead. He comes across as a natural born leader. Richard Vasseur
